Racers Close Semester With Win at Gamecock Open
11/19/2022 11:17:00 PM | Rifle
MSU eclipses 4700 to finish first in four team match
The Murray State rifle team closed out its fall semester with a win at the 2022 Gamecock Classic Saturday hosted by Jacksonville State at the Gamecock Rifle Range in Jacksonville, Alabama. The Racers used a 2335 smallbore and a 2373 air rifle to reach the 4700 benchmark for the second time this season with a 4708 aggregate.
Paola Paravati helped lead the Racers with a 586 smallbore and a career best 595 air rifle for a team-high aggregate of 1181. John Blanton led Murray State in smallbore with a 587, while shooting a 592 in air rifle for an aggregate of 1179. Other big scores on the day came from Matias Kiuru in smallbore at 584 and Allison Henry in air rifle at 594.
With the fall semester complete, the Racers will return to action Jan. 14 at UT Martin.
